lmmp.net
当前位置:首页 >> 数据库表结构设计 >>

数据库表结构设计

1) 不应该针对整个系统进行数据库设计,而应该根据系统架构中的组件划分,针对每个组件所处理的业务进行组件单元的数据库设计;不同组件间所对应的数据库表之 间的关联应尽可能减少,如果不同组件间的表需要外键关联也尽量不要创建外键关联,而...

一般可将数据库结构设计分为四个阶段,即需求分析、概念结构设计、逻辑结构设计和物理设计。 数据字典(Data Dictionary DD)用于记载系统定义的或中间生成的各种数据、数据元素,以及常量、变量、数组及其他数据单位,说明它们的名字、性质、意...

数据库设计(Database Design)是指对于一个给定的应用环境,构造最优的数据库模式,建立数据库及其应用系统,使之能够有效地存储数据,满足各种用户的应用需求(信息要求和处理要求)。 在数据库领域内,常常把使用数据库的各类系统统称为数据库...

就拿你所例举的例子来说,一张入库单可能对用多个物料,如果不是采用主从表的形式,那么你的主表的数据就会有大量的重复。通常有多少物料就会重复多少次。这对系统的资源是很大的浪费。其实这种情况在数据库基础的知识学习当中是有专门的范式约...

tb_id int//主键 tb_name_before varchar//上传时候的名字,便与下载让他名字恢复 tb_name_now str2 varchar//上传的时候重命名的,防与其他文件重名,一般用日期加时间表示 tb_address str3 varchar//服务器路径 tb_date dates varchar//上传日...

1、把你表中经常查询的和不常用的分开几个表,也就是横向切分 2、把不同类型的分成几个表,纵向切分 3、常用联接的建索引 4、服务器放几个硬盘,把数据、日志、索引分盘存放,这样可以提高IO吞吐率 5、用优化器,优化你的查询 6、考虑冗余,这样...

表结构的设计和维护,是在表结构设计器中完成的

一般项目开发是这样的,有需求之后 分两步走。 1,美工设计页面布局, 2程序员(组长了,项目经理了,)设计数据库(看项目大小了。如果小项目程序员直接开发直接设计了)。如果是大项目可能数据库设计就比较重要了,从e-r图了什么的开始设计到...

用一句SQL就好了,但是合并的前提条件要格式统一: Select * from 表1 UNION Select * from 表2 ; 结构不同你也可以合并,挑选出合并项就好了: Select [表1].[字段1],[表1].[字段2],[表1].[字段3] from 表1 UNION Select [表2].[字段1],[表2].[...

如果数据量不大的情况下无所谓,如果还有历史记录且数据量不小,大于千万级别的,建议你进行分拆成不同的表,所有的分表都有相同的日期字段,如果有其他相同属性,也要建立好外键关系

网站首页 | 网站地图
All rights reserved Powered by www.lmmp.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com